Transaction dbfcdd147c2f8d2fad29e3b58f8d1f88bef290a1121d007e1ecfd19cedcafbc2
1 Input
1 Output
-
dbfcdd147c2f8d2fad29e3b58f8d1f88bef290a1121d007e1ecfd19cedcafbc2:0
- value
- 49987110
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d66265157cbcc19c7ec8d9e3d0ac1af7b08524d9 OP_EQUAL
- address
- 3MEaQByr4n8CAchBSKwB9JwmVMJL9oM6Vg